2023-01-17 10:01:52 -08:00
|
|
|
FROM --platform=linux/amd64 node:lts-alpine as builder
|
2023-01-12 16:53:22 -08:00
|
|
|
|
|
|
|
# Create app directory
|
2023-01-17 10:01:52 -08:00
|
|
|
WORKDIR /usr/src/app
|
2023-01-12 16:53:22 -08:00
|
|
|
|
|
|
|
# COPY package.json package-lock.json /src/
|
|
|
|
|
|
|
|
# ENV NODE_ENV=production
|
|
|
|
# RUN npm ci
|
|
|
|
|
|
|
|
# Install app dependencies
|
|
|
|
# COPY . /src
|
|
|
|
|
|
|
|
COPY . .
|
|
|
|
|
|
|
|
CMD [ "npm", "run", "k8s-testnet" ]
|